I was wondering why the power lead i recently uncovered has one of the
cables tied in a knot.
Its a 12V power cable with an adapter for running a radio transceiver from
the ciggie lighter socket in a car.

While trying to figure out why I would have done that it dawned on me that
bare ends of the leads could short together and so by shotening one lead,
the problem can be avoided!

I havent used any radio equipment in a car now for about 18 years, but at
least I was thinking about electrical safety. :-)
